Spillway Classic Trail Run

Norco, United States • 13 Jul 2025

The Spillway Classic Trail Run is an annual 3-mile trail race held at the Bonnet Carre Spillway in Norco, Louisiana. Celebrating its 38th year in 2025, the event features "The Gauntlet," a challenging off-road course through natural trails with unpaved surfaces and potential elevation changes. Runners navigate a dynamic Louisiana landscape that may be muddy or wet depending on recent weather. Open to all runners and walkers, the race welcomes both New Orleans Track Club members and nonmembers. Post-race refreshments include local favorites like beer, Chee-Wees, sweets, and jambalaya, creating a festive and community-oriented atmosphere.
